Given:
After driving for 20 minutes, Juan was 62 miles away from his apartment.
After driving for 32 minutes Juan was only 38 miles away.
The time driving and the distance away from his apartment form a linear relationship.
To find:
The independent and dependent variables.
Solution:
If the value of a variable depends on the another, then it is called dependent variables.
If the value of a variable does not depend on the another, then it is called independent variables.
In the given problem, the distance of Juan from his apartment depends on the time he drove. So,
Dependent variable = Distance of Juan from his apartment in miles.
Independent variable = Time he drove
